Introduction

What is TCT?

Translator Component Toolkit is a python library that allowing users to explore and use KGs in the Translator ecosystem. Users can check out the key function documentations here: https://ncatstranslator.github.io/Translator_component_toolkit/

Key features for TCT

Allowing users to select APIs, predicates according to the user's intention.
Parallel and fast quering of the selected APIs.
Providing reproducible results by setting contraints.
Allowing testing whether a user defined API follows a TRAPI standard or not.
Faciliting to explore knowledge graphs from both Translator ecosystem and user defined APIs.
Connecting large language models to convert user's questions into TRAPI queries.

How to use TCT

Install Requirments

To install TCT as a python library, you can install the library using pip install TCT from the command line. The current released version is TCT.0.1.0. This the recommended approach for installation.

The TCT is continuously updated, if you would like to use the latest functions, you can also clone this repository, and then run pip install -e . from this folder.

Contributing

TCT is a tool that helps to explore knowledge graphs developed in the Biomedical Data Translator Consortium. Consortium members and external contributors are encouraged to submit issues and pull requests.
